3 if ifclass GERMAN
; then
4 $ROOTCMD locale-gen LANG
=de_DE.UTF-8
5 $ROOTCMD update-locale LANG
=de_DE.UTF-8
7 ainsl
-v /etc
/locale.gen
'^en_US.UTF-8 UTF-8'
9 $ROOTCMD update-locale LANG
=en_US.UTF-8
12 # check if we already use an external mirror
13 grep -q "external mirror" $target/etc
/apt
/sources.list
&& exit 0
15 cat <<EOM > $target/etc/apt/sources.list
17 deb MIRRORURL $ubuntudist main restricted universe multiverse
18 deb MIRRORURL $ubuntudist-updates main restricted universe multiverse
19 deb MIRRORURL $ubuntudist-security main restricted universe multiverse
22 # determine a fast mirror for Ubuntu
23 list
=$
(curl
-s http
://mirrors.ubuntu.com
/mirrors.txt
)
24 mirror
=$
(netselect
$list |
awk '{print $2}')
25 sed -i -e "s#MIRRORURL#$mirror#" $target/etc
/apt
/sources.list